2022 MCJLS sale earns over $320,000

Milam County Junior Livestock Show exhibitors took home $320,135 before added money during the Premium Livestock Sale on Saturday night.

The Grand Champion steer exhibited by Thorndale 4-Her Kennedy Hobbs brought $16,000. The Reserve Champion steer was exhibited by Kenzie Hobbs of the Thorndale 4-H.

Thorndale FFA member Kinley Meadors exhibited the Grand Champion swine. The Reserve Champion swine was exhibited by Thorndale 4-Her Riley Clinard.

Thorndale FFA member Jenna Lindig exhibited the Grand Champion lamb. The Reserve Champion lamb was exhibited by Thorndale FFA member Kale Meadors.

Cameron 4-Her J.W. Hollas exhibited the Grand Champion pen of broilers. The Reserve Champion broilers were exhibited by J.W. Minatrea of the Cameron FFA.

Rockdale FFA member Madison Gonzales exhibited the Grand Champion rabbits. The Reserve Champion rabbits were exhibited by Cameron FFA member Brooklyn Summers.

Rockdale FFA member Kayla Ehler exhibited the Grand Champion turkey. Milano 4-Her Cooper Popham exhibited the Reserve Champion turkey.

Thorndale 4-Her Kyrene Jackson exhibited the Grand Champion goat. The Reserve Champion goat was exhibited by Thorndale 4-Her Jacob Jackson.

Milano 4-Her Caylee Butler exhibited the Grand Champion pen of commercial heifers. The Reserve Champion pen of commercial heifers was exhibited by Cameron 4-Her Wylie Butler.

Showmanship awards went to: steers – senior Mason Leifeste, junior Wylie Butler, and peewee Wacey Butler; swine – senior Hadley Meadors, junior Riley Clinard, and peewee Camryn Travis; lambs – senior Garrett Reed, junior Kale Meadors, and peewee Laramie Mahan; broilers – senior J.W. Hollas, junior Hayden Johnson, and peewee Callen Vaculin; turkeys – senior Montgomery Popham, junior Isabella Alexander, and peewee Hayes Berry; goats – senior Kyrene Jackson, junior Wyatt Woods, and peewee Madison Stewart; and rabbits – senior Landon Terry, junior Carlie Eason, and peewee Kinsley Bailey.
